Preclinical Imaging Laboratory Advisory Committee
Our advisory committee is composed of members of NYU Langone leadership and meets semi-annually to review the following:
- usage statistics
- budget and financial oversight
- hardware performance status and integration with other technologies
- scientific performance and productivity, including grant funding and the number of abstracts and papers emerging from the use of our instruments
- outreach to possible new users
Our lab director is a nonvoting member of the committee, as is required by the National Institutes of Health funding guidelines on shared instrumentation and resources.
